Depends on if you mean the words to the song La Raza by Kid Frost or just the words La Raza. La Raza means "the race", but more correctly "the people".
There is no connection except that Our Lady of Guadalupe made her appearance in Mexico and La Raza members are usually Mexican or of Mexican descent. Actually, La Raza makes little sense since there is no Mexican or Hispanic race.
